Stafford Train Station is a well-equipped facility offering a host of amenities to ensure a comfortable journey. The ticket office is open from 6:00 AM to 8:00 PM on weekdays and from 8:30 AM to 8:00 PM on Sundays, with ticket machines available for convenience. For those who prefer using smartcards, there are validators ready for use. The station prides itself on accessibility, offering step-free access to all platforms, accessible ticket machines, and induction loops to assist those with hearing impairments.
Travelers can find assistance at the help point and information point, with screens displaying departure and arrival information. CCTV is operational for enhanced security. Though luggage storage isn't available, staff members are ever-present to offer their help, especially between 7:30 AM and midnight on Sundays.
Stafford Station ensures that all travelers have equal access to its services. Wheelchair accessibility is guaranteed, with ramps for train access and accessible toilets available on all platforms, including baby changing facilities. Though there are no accessible taxis directly at the station, the impaired mobility set-down/pick-up points offer a workaround. With such thoughtful accommodations, Stafford Station strives to make every client’s journey as smooth and hassle-free as possible.
While waiting for your train, you can enjoy various refreshment facilities and do some quick shopping. There are ATMs readily available for cash withdrawals. Although there is no public Wi-Fi, payphones are accessible for those needing to make quick calls.
Two car parks, operated by Avanti West Coast, offer a plethora of spaces for travelers, with Car Park 1 offering 75 spaces and Car Park 2 a significant 467 spaces. Charges vary, with a daily rate of £12.50, and they’re open 24 hours a day, seven days a week. Cyclists can take advantage of 126 bicycle storage spaces, with both sheltered and CCTV-monitored areas for peace of mind. When arriving at Cressing (Essex) station, passengers will notice the absence of a traditional ticket office. However, fear not, as ticket machines are on hand for both ticket collection and purchase, ensuring you’re ready to board your train. Furthermore, these machines are accessible, catering to everyone’s needs. Customer information is easily accessible through departure screens and announcements, while a help point is available for any assistance needed.
For those requiring accessibility features, the station boasts step-free access to the single platform serving trains to Braintree and Witham. It’s classified as a Category B1 station by the Office of Rail and Road (ORR), indicating that step-free access is available in parts. Unfortunately, there's a lack of accessible bathrooms or waiting rooms on site, but a comfortable seating area is available for those waiting for onward travel.
